2. Difficulties Of Reusing Solar Panels
It is widely approved that recycling photovoltaic panels has lots of ecological advantages, however, it is likewise real that the process isn't without its challenges. Yet what exactly are these obstacles? Allow's explore even more.
Among the greatest issues with recycling solar panels is the complexity of the job itself. It can be difficult to break down the different parts, such as glass and steel, to be recycled separately. Furthermore, solar panel makers typically have a mix of materials used in their items that makes arranging them even more challenging. In addition, there are security and health and wellness dangers included with dealing with damaged glass or inhaling fumes from melting components.
An additional crucial obstacle related to recycling solar panels is price. https://www.curbed.com/2022/05/ikea-solar-panels-for-sale-california.html of countries do not have adequate infrastructure or resources to adequately recycle these things which brings about greater expenditures for services attempting to do so. Furthermore, due to the customized nature of reusing photovoltaic panels, this can create a monetary worry on firms trying to remain certified with policies. Eventually, these prices could be given to customers making it difficult for them to afford renewable resource resources.

3. Approaches For Recycling Solar Panels
As the world strives for a much more lasting future, reusing solar panels is an increasingly preferred task. In the middle of this expanding passion, nevertheless, we need to take into consideration the techniques that are in area to make it feasible.
To start with, lots of firms have applied a 'take-back' system wherein old or damaged solar panels can be collected and sent out to their particular factories for reusing. By doing this, the products have the ability to be reused in the building of brand-new items. Moreover, some towns have actually even started offering rewards for people desiring to reuse their photovoltaic panels; this might vary from tax obligation breaks to free delivery prices.
In addition, innovation has become progressively advanced when it concerns recycling photovoltaic panels-- with specialized makers with the ability of separating out all the various components within them. For example, by using AI-powered robotic arms, these devices can draw out useful materials such as copper and aluminium while also disposing of hazardous waste safely.
